The Problem: Manual Orders, Blind Status, and Costly Remakes

After diagnosis and treatment planning, ordering oral appliances was a manual nightmare — emailing STL files, faxing prescriptions, calling labs for status updates, and guessing when the appliance would arrive. Miscommunication led to 20% remake rates and 3-4 week average delivery times.

A multi-provider practice ordering 30+ appliances per month had zero visibility into manufacturing status. Doctors would ask "Where's the appliance?" and the answer was always "Let me call the lab." Remakes alone cost $36K per year.

The goal was to build an end-to-end digital ordering system with fit calculations, automated prescriptions, real-time tracking, and lab performance analytics — all within the existing clinical platform.

Our Solution

Digital Order & Prescription System
  • STL file attachment directly from 3D scan records
  • Fit calculation engine for precise appliance specifications
  • Digital prescription auto-generated from patient case data
Jaw Positioning & Specification Engine
  • Jaw positioning analysis for accurate positioning parameters
  • Specification validation to prevent errors before submission
  • Order submission reduced from 2 days to 5 minutes
Real-Time Manufacturing Tracking
  • Live status pipeline: Ordered → In Production → Quality Check → Shipped → Delivered
  • Appliance status visible on the patient case dashboard
  • Delivery notification triggers fitting appointment auto-scheduling
Lab Communication & Analytics
  • Lab-to-practice messaging within the platform
  • Lab performance analytics: turnaround time, remake rate, quality scores
  • Full audit trail of every order, change, and communication

Challenges: Manual Ordering and Zero Visibility

Manual, Error-Prone Ordering Process

Emailing STL files and faxing prescriptions introduced specification errors, lost files, and miscommunication — resulting in a 20% remake rate costing $36K per year.

No Manufacturing Status Visibility

Practices had no way to track appliance status without calling the lab, leading to wasted staff time and inability to schedule fitting appointments proactively.

Specification Errors and Remakes

Without fit calculation engines or specification validation, appliance orders frequently contained errors that weren't caught until the appliance arrived and didn't fit.

Disconnected Lab Communication

Communication with labs happened via phone, email, and fax — none of it tracked, none of it linked to the patient record, and none of it visible to the rest of the care team.
